Oihan Guillamoundeguy is currently ranked 303rd in the world as of the most recent November 10 world rankings.
Oihan Guillamoundeguy's peak world ranking occured on October 27, 2025, when he was ranked #295 with 0.513 world ranking points.
No, Oihan Guillamoundeguy has not won any major championships.
| Year | Ranking | Points |
|---|